Operation
All functions of W70 Series Mix Proof valves are pneumatically
controlled using a 75 min. to 90 max. psi (5.2 to 6.2 bar) clean air
supply.
The valve contains a large and small spring in the valve actuator.
The springs compress the valve seats to seal closed.
Large Spring
•
Located in top air chamber of cylinder.
•
Holds valve in the closed position.
Small Spring
•
Located in the extended hub of the upper piston.
•
When the valve is open, the spring acts on the upper seat
stem to hold the upper and lower plugs together.

Up to three air supplies controlled by solenoid valves supply air to
the valve actuator (Figure 11).
Table 3: Solenoid/Valve Position
Condition
Solenoid 1
Solenoid 2
Solenoid 3
Closed
OFF
OFF
OFF
Open
ON
OFF
OFF
Upper Seat Clean *
OFF
ON
OFF
Lower Seat Clean *
OFF
OFF
ON
1 = Valve Open Inlet Solenoid
2 = Upper Seat Clean Inlet Solenoid*
3 = Lower Seat Clean Inlet Solenoid*
ON = Solenoid energized (OPEN). LED is lit.
OFF = Solenoid de-energized (CLOSED). LED is off.
Solenoids are normally closed.
Air connections are 1/8" NPT x 1/4" push-to-connect poly tube
fittings.
* Seat lifting is an option which requires (2) two additional air
supplies. Non-seat lifting valves (NSL) only have one air inlet (1).
For specific air-routing and solenoid porting, please refer to
control module publication 95-03083.
